Infobright - Infobright

Infobright, Inc.
Частный
ПромышленностьКорпоративное программное обеспечение & Управление базой данных & Хранилище данных
Основан2005; 15 лет назад (2005)
ОсновательКас Апанович
Доминик Слензак
Петр Сынак
Якуб Врублевски
Штаб-квартираТоронто, Онтарио, Канада
ПродуктыInfobright Enterprise Edition (ранее Brighthouse), Infobright Community Edition
Интернет сайтinfobright.com

Infobright является коммерческим поставщиком столбчатый реляционная база данных программное обеспечение с акцентом на машинные данные. Головной офис компании находится в г. Торонто, Онтарио, Канада. Большая часть его исследований и разработок основана на Варшава, Польша. Персонал службы поддержки находится в различных офисах по всему миру.

История

Infobright была основана в 2005 году. Она стала Открытый исходный код компании в сентябре 2008 года, когда она выпустила первую бесплатную версию своего программного обеспечения. Тогда же был запущен его сайт сообщества.[1]

Компания финансируется венчурный капитал инвесторы Flybridge Capital Partners и информационные венчурные партнеры.[нужна цитата ]

В 2009 году Infobright была признана партнером года по MySQL,[2] и Gartner Отличный поставщик в области управления данными и интеграции.[3] Он также сертифицирован для использования с линейкой продуктов Sun Unified Storage.[4] Правопреемник опубликованных патентных заявок на сжатие данных,[5] оптимизация запросов,[6] и организация данных.[7]

В июле 2016 года Infobright официально отказалась от своей версии сообщества с открытым исходным кодом, чтобы сосредоточиться на своих OEM и рынки прямых клиентов.

Технологии

Infobright Enterprise Edition (IEE)

Программное обеспечение базы данных Infobright интегрировано с MySQL,[8] но со своим собственным запатентованным хранилищем данных и уровнями оптимизации запросов.

Infobright использует столбчатый подход к проектированию базы данных. Когда данные загружаются в таблицу, они разбиваются на группы по 216 строк, которые затем разбиваются на отдельные пакеты данных для каждого из столбцов. Разбивая каждый столбец на такое же количество строк, он сохраняет свою целостность с другими столбцами той же записи. Например, строка 1, столбец 1 - это первая запись в первом пакете данных для столбца 1. Строка 1 в столбце 2 - это первая запись в первом пакете данных для столбца 2.

Каждый пакет данных отдельно сжатый в среднем примерно до 20: 1.

Infobright Enterprise Edition доступен в PostgreSQL и MySQL.

Сетка знанийСлой метаданных (называемый сеткой знаний базы данных) хранит компактную информацию о содержимом и отношениях между пакетами данных, заменяя концепцию традиционного индекс базы данных.[9]

Выполнение запросаОптимизатор использует теории грубые наборы и Гранулярные вычисления путем категоризации пакетов данных, которые необходимо распаковать, и уточнения такой категоризации с использованием частичных результатов, полученных из таблицы знаний, и уже распакованных пакетов данных.[10]

использованная литература

  1. ^ «Хранилище данных с открытым исходным кодом, программное обеспечение для баз данных столбцов, повышение производительности SQL». Сайт сообщества. Архивировано из оригинал 19 октября 2011 г.. Получено 17 октября, 2011.
  2. ^ Партнеры года по MySQL 2009 В архиве 2009-05-01 на Wayback Machine Sun представляет награды MySQL 2009
  3. ^ Крутые поставщики в области управления данными и интеграции, 2009 г. Отчет Gartner G00165365
  4. ^ Сертификация Secure Sun для редакций Infobright. TMCNet.com, 23 апреля 2009 г.
  5. ^ Метод и система сжатия данных в реляционной базе данных. Заявка на патент США 2008/0071818 A1
  6. ^ Метод и система для хранения, организации и обработки данных в реляционной базе данных. Заявка на патент США 2008/0071748 A1
  7. ^ Методы и системы организации базы данных. Заявка на патент США 2009/0106210 A1
  8. ^ Хранилище данных Infobright В архиве 2009-05-08 на Wayback Machine. MySQL, сентябрь 2008 г.
  9. ^ Brighthouse: хранилище аналитических данных для для этого случая запросы В архиве 2016-05-07 в Wayback Machine. Отраслевые бумаги VLDB 2008
  10. ^ Грубые наборы в хранилищах данных. РНТЦ 2008 приглашенный доклад